
In the first half of 2023, China's equipment manufacturing landscape has undergone a remarkable transformation, with exports reaching unprecedented levels. The sector recorded a notable growth of 15% compared to the same period last year, showcasing the resilience and competitiveness of Chinese manufacturers. Factors such as technological advancements, strategic investments, and governmental support have played a crucial role in this surge.
